About the Tournament
In order to address our mission we provide resources & education to those with SCI; serve as principal sponsor of The Midwest Ability Summit, allowing attendees access to education; information from local resources; interact with speakers & area service providers; offer transportation for individuals unable to return to driving; award grants/funding for those in the SCI community in need of donation/scholarship. Including, for example, grants to local quad rugby & wheelchair basketball teams or sponsoring individuals to attend Roll on the Hill (advocacy & leadership meeting in Washington DC). As a volunteer based 501 (C) 3 organization our Annual Golf Tournament is designed to help raise the funds needed to achieve these goals and more.
